    Would you be able to sometime do a video with sublimation settings start to finish on the epson 2800 with the Mac please

    • @industrialfringe953
      @industrialfringe953  11 місяців тому +2

      There’s really not a lot of settings! I print at 100% (because all of my files are designed to print that way), I use the Plain Paper option, and I put the quality to the far right, Best. I believe I have a quick screenshot in the video. That’s it! No color profile or anything else!

    • @industrialfringe953
      @industrialfringe953  8 місяців тому

      Brown typically means you’re overcooking. I’ve had great results with blacks using Cyclone, so you may want to try and lower time and/or temp.
